1954 Alfa Romeo 6C vs. 1957 DKW Munga
To start off, 1957 DKW Munga is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C would be higher. At 3,494 cc (6 cylinders), 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C (271 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 234 more horse power than 1957 DKW Munga. (37 HP @ 4200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C should accelerate faster than 1957 DKW Munga.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1957 DKW Munga weights approximately 334 kg more than 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C.
Because 1957 DKW Munga is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1954 Alfa Romeo 6C.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1957 DKW Munga will offer significantly more control.
